Output 8b907dfc60449d6c009b28df927331f3a27c092229a3461a5414d59360474291:0

value
1405865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ea5e9b5ab0154ce3c71260c014f3e549f213ae OP_EQUAL
address
3Du6ZLeaVRmMkxVTbzGnecY8k3mQyPswug
transaction
8b907dfc60449d6c009b28df927331f3a27c092229a3461a5414d59360474291
spent
true